Output d80f053e64c14438caf88c2631a300d04f3c14c65d86685f937a70b6b9515a5a:93

value
164825
script pubkey
OP_0 OP_PUSHBYTES_20 f143b97199cf1dae80a5302fb991079cd21e4fc9
address
bc1q79pmjuveeuw6aq99xqhmnyg8nnfpun7fjvjgw0
transaction
d80f053e64c14438caf88c2631a300d04f3c14c65d86685f937a70b6b9515a5a
spent
true